The historian Ramaprasad Chanda mentioned in 1916 that Durga developed eventually while in the Indian subcontinent. A primitive method of Durga, In line with Chanda, was the results of "syncretism of a mountain-goddess worshipped because of the dwellers from the Himalaya along with the Vindhyas", a deity of the Abhiras conceptualised being a war-goddess.

In the course of the initial 9 days, 9 elements of Durga known as Navadurga are meditated on, one by one in the course of the nine-working day festival by devout Hindus. Durga is often worshipped as being a celibate goddess, although the Shaktism traditions contains the worship of Shiva coupled with Durga, who's thought of as his consort, Together with Lakshmi, Saraswati, Ganesha and Kartikeya, who will be regarded as being Durga's small children by Shaktas.

C. Ambika: Ambika is actually a sort of Durga that signifies the nurturing and protecting components of motherhood. She is commonly depicted with multiple arms, holding numerous weapons and products to symbolize her protective nature. Ambika is observed like a source of assistance and help for her devotees.

Durga Puja is really a grand celebration focused on Goddess Durga and is probably the most vital festivals in India, specifically in West Bengal. It always usually takes place over a period of ten days, with elaborate rituals, cultural performances, and artistic displays.
